5 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) One such open standard supported by Aastra is SIP. Aastra has a large range of SIP terminals and its Call Servers and PBX range are SIP compatible. SIP protocol is natively included in Aastra s Aastra 5000 /MX-ONE solution. This signaling protocol was driven by the Internet Engineering Task Force (IETF) and has been widely adopted by the Voice over IP community. SIP is a simple protocol for initiating, terminating and modifying sessions in an IP network. It works alongside existing protocols and standards to provide the following basic functions: Establish user location: the nature of a VoIP user means that their IP address may be constantly changing. SIP maps the user s name to their current network address Feature negotiation: session participants can agree the features or media capabilities to be supported amongst them.sip allows for these features to be changed whilst a session is in progress Call management: SIP provides a mechanism for call management, for example, adding, dropping or transferring participants Sessions established using SIP are fully scalable ranging from a simple two-way telephone call to a full-blown multi-media conference call. SIP closely resembles other internet protocols enabling telephony to become another web application which integrates easily into other internet services. SIP is evolving and was designed by the IETF to be extensible, accommodating new, emerging protocols and mechanisms. By embracing this protocol Aastra ensure that their customers will continue to benefit from a seamless converged communications solution and true multi-vendor integration. 6 IEEE-802.1X This is a simple, standards-based mechanism that performs secure logon ensuring that only authenticated and verified users/devices can access network resources. The 802.1X mechanism allows you to transform your network from being completely open to one where the ports are closed by default, until opened by an authenticated user or device. It then uses the 802.1X logon of the device, or user, as a means of authentication prior to granting access to the network. Aastra has also embraced this technology and 802.1X is supported on many of their IP phones. This ensures that wherever users are connected to the network they can be identified, verified against a centralized(radius) database and then granted or denied network access, as appropriate. However, IP phones typically have a second IP networking port through which other devices, such as a notebook, may be connected to the network. This poses serious security concerns. HP Networking switches address these concerns by supporting multiple 802.1X sessions simultaneously on each port. So, for example, the first session can authenticate an IP phone and the second, a notebook connected via this phone. This effectively ensures that the same level of security can be extended to any device connected to the network via IP phones. Once the identity of both the device and the user has been established, the network can be adapted to deliver different services. These services are dependent upon profiles held on the Radius server which are, in turn, managed by HP Networking s IDM software. 7 LLDP-MED Link Level Discovery Protocol - Media Endpoint Discovery (LLDP-MED) is an extension to the existing LLDP (IEEE 802.1ab) standard and addresses the unique demands of video and voice in a converged network. The workgroup for this new technology was initiated by HP Networking Labs in order to focus better on customer requirements for Voice and Video over IP. HP Networking played a pivotal role in driving this open industry standard and was one of the first to market with solutions based on LLDP-MED. The standard has subsequently been adopted at a rapid pace and has been implemented by the majority of network industry players including Aastra in their new generation of IP phones. LLDP-MED is a milestone for multi-vendor VoIP environments, it offers notable technological benefits and helps to significantly reduce operational costs: Device location discovery: With traditional PBX telephony systems it is possible to trace the physical origin of calls. The nature of VoIP, however, makes this very difficult. LLDP-MED enables the IP phone, or any other multi-media device, to obtain its physical location information automatically upon connection to the network. This is, for example, vital for reporting the location of a user making an emergency call. Plug-and-play provisioning: Eliminates the need to manually configure the phone or switch port when deploying new IP phones, or for any subsequent moves, additions and modifications. This not only reduces operator and configuration errors but it also makes initial deployments and subsequent changes significantly quicker, reducing the total cost of ownership of the whole IP communications infrastructure. Detailed inventory management: Allows network administrators to track their VoIP devices. The Ethernet switch collects model, manufacturer, software, firmware and asset information, thereby simplifying the management and maintenance of inventory. Advanced PoE functionality: The current PoE standard (IEEE 802.3af) provides a maximum of 15.4 watts per port and allows IP devices to receive power as well as data over existing LAN cabling. However it is likely that the standard wattage supplied by PoE will increase and that more power-demanding devices and appliances will need to be supported. With this in mind, LLDP-MED enables phones and other devices to manage power consumption more effectively, for example fine-grained power allocation and endpoint power priority settings. 7

8 Voice over Wi-Fi HP Networking and Aastra also have a very strong combined wireless telephony solution enabling organizations to leverage their wireless LAN infrastructure investment for both voice and data. Aastra offers SIP Wi-Fi phones supporting802.11e/wmm quality of service and uaspd Power-Save features. HP Networking provides a full range of wireless products including Access Points and wireless controllers supporting Voice over Wi-Fi industry open-standards. Furthermore, HP Networking s unified wired and wireless strategy enables the customer to seamlessly integrate both their wired and wireless networks with one unique platform to manage and secure this entire network. A combined HP Networking/Aastra solution ensures that Voice over Wi-Fi is a logical extension of the network delivering advanced functionality to the mobile user throughout the workplace.
